Positive IMF review paves way for $2B transfer to Egypt

The latest review by the International Monetary Fund has found that Egypt's economic reforms are on track, paving the way for the transfer of another $2 billion loan disbursement, part of a three-year bailout loan.

Half the Saudi population receiving welfare in new system

Saudi Arabia has paid 2 billion riyals ($533 million) in the first monthly installment of a new welfare system for low and middle-income Saudi families that make up approximately half of the kingdom's population.

Trump orders boost in production of critical minerals

President Donald Trump on Wednesday ordered the government to boost production of critical minerals used for manufacturing everything from smartphones to wind turbines and cars, raising the prospect of more mining.

Shell, Eni face corruption charges in corporate bribery case

A judge in Milan has ordered the current and former CEOs of the Italian oil giant Eni to face trial on corruption charges for the alleged payment of bribes over the $1.1 billion sale of one of Africa's richest oil blocks in Nigeria.
